Book excerpt: Physical Distribution is a distinct but integral part of business logistics, involving all those activities relating to the physical movement of goods from the factory to the consumer. Recently, the concept has been expanded to supply chain management which enables better customer relationship with smooth supply of goods. Book excerpt: The 1980's witnessed the first step - change in managing the logistics function when stock centralization, contracting out and investment in technologies made a massive impact. The 1990's have experienced further changes that have been mainly concerned with incremental improvements and relationship changes. Retailers are now focusing on the whole supply chain instead of being primarily concerned with physical distribution management. The emphasis now is on quick response, efficient consumer response, category management and continuous replenishment - in short, the key is relationships.
